The SKLZ Accelerator Pro is a 2.75-meter mat with automatic ball return: when you sink the putt, the ball rolls back to you along a side channel. The mat simulates the texture of a fast green and has printed alignment markers to work on the line of the putt. According to user reviews on Amazon.es, it is easy to set up, takes up little space at home and holds up to daily use. Its strong point is letting you repeat the putting stroke continuously without having to retrieve the ball after each stroke.

The PuttOut Pressure Putt Trainer is a precision target in the shape of a curved ramp: if the putt goes in at the right speed, the ball is caught in the center; if it goes too hard, the ramp returns it in proportion to the force of the stroke, replicating how far it would have rolled past the hole on the green. According to user reviews on Amazon.es, it is the accessory that fastest improves stroke consistency, because every putt has real consequences: either you hole it or the ball tells you exactly how much you overhit it.

The SKLZ Accelerator Pro and the PuttOut complement each other well: many users use them together, placing the PuttOut at the end of the SKLZ mat to combine line and speed practice with stroke precision.

If you want to practice long sessions at home, repeat the putting stroke continuously and work on alignment, the SKLZ Accelerator Pro is the best option: the automatic return makes the session smoother and less tedious.

If you want to improve the precision of your stroke, know exactly whether your pace is right and have an accessory you can take to the course or the club, the PuttOut Pressure Putt Trainer is the smarter choice.

If you have the budget for both, combine them: put the PuttOut at the end of the SKLZ mat and you have a complete putting station.

Can you use the PuttOut on any surface? Yes. It works on carpet, hardwood, tile and putting mats. The smoother and more even the surface, the more accurate the feedback.

Does the SKLZ Accelerator Pro fit in a small flat? You need at least 3 meters of length to lay it out fully. If you do not have that space, the PuttOut Pressure Putt Trainer is more practical thanks to its compact size.

How many strokes a day with these accessories make a real difference? According to user reviews, with 15-20 minute sessions daily for two or three weeks you notice clear improvements in stroke consistency. The key is repetition with attention to the stroke, not the number of balls.

Can you use these accessories with any putter? Yes, they are compatible with any standard putter. There are no restrictions on head size or shaft length.
